Transaction 58250fcc15f358a6b71d7549f54370f3cc828de33b2f59801560fa01ac541819

1 Input
2 Outputs
  • 58250fcc15f358a6b71d7549f54370f3cc828de33b2f59801560fa01ac541819:0
  • value  124878
    address  1EH94JN3fadA3kFTxiKzzp4WCrrcR5a27y
  • 58250fcc15f358a6b71d7549f54370f3cc828de33b2f59801560fa01ac541819:1
  • value  141433183
    address  37biYvTEcBVMoR1NGkPTGvHUuLTrzcLpiv